GofFee Bavarian Cream. Use 1 cup of strpng coffee and 1 cup of milk for the custaird. Prepare same as Bavarian cream. Almond Bavarian Cream. One-half a box of gelatine, 1 pilit of cream, 1 pint of sweet al- monds, blanched and pounded to a paste. Dissolve gelatine in milk, add 2 cups granulated sugar, yolks of 2 eggs. Prepare the custard with gelatine, stir and cook 1 minute. When cold add almonds and whipped cream. Put in mold to congeal. Frozen Orange SoufSe. One quart of cream, 1 pint orange juice, 1 pound powdered sugar, % box /gelatine, % cup cold water, yolks of 4 eggs, % cup boiling waterFrozen Orange Soufflé. Soak gelatine in the cold water half an hour, then add boiling water and stir until gelatine is dissolved. Mix orange juice and sugar, then add yolks beaten to a cream, then add gela- tine. Beat mixture until frothy, strain and freeze. When frozen stir in the whipped cream and leave 2 hours to ripen. Raspberry Cream. One quart of cream, 1 pint pink raspberry juice, 1% tumblers granulated sugarRaspberry Cream. Add 1 tumbler of sugar to cream and whip, then rest of sugar to juice. Dissolve thoroughly. Add the cream and freeze. Pineapple Cream. Three pints of cream, 1 fresh pineapple, 14 ounces granulated sugarPineapple Cream. Chop pineapple fine. When cream is nearly frozen stir in pineapple and freeze. Velvet Cream. One quart of cream, 1 pint of milk, 14 ounces of granulated sugar, .14 box of gelatine and % pint of sherry wineVelvet Cream. Soak gela- tine in milk 30 minutes. Put in double boiler, add sugar and set on range; stir until dissolved. While warm add whipped cream and wine. Put in mold to harden. Nougat Charlotte. One-half cup of blanched almonds, % cup of grated cocoanut, % pint of cream, % cup of powdered sugar, whites of 2 eggs, 5 drops of almond extractNougat Charlotte. Chop almonds and cocoanut in y^ cup of granu- lated sus^ar, then pound to a paste. Whip cream stiff and add sugar and beaten whites, cocoanut, almonds and flavoring. Pour this into a mold lined with lady fingers. Velvet Mousse. One quart of cream, yolks of 3 eggs, 2 cups granulated sugar, 292 KENTUCKY BECEIFT BOOK. 1% teaspoons vanilla. Make a syrup of sugar and water, cook until almost candy. Beat yolks light and pour the symp slowly over, stir well, add vanilla. Have the cream whipped, add syrup. Grease mold on the edge at top, pour in the cream and pack in ice and salt 4 hours. Half the recipe may be used. Frozen Coffee. • Put 1 quart of cream in a bowl and add 1 pint of granulated sugar, 1 pint of strong cold coflfeeFrozen Coffee. Whip till a stiff froth, then pour into freezer and pack with salt and ice. Let stand 2 hours. Serve in small glass cups. Pineapple Oream. Chop 1 can pineapple very fine and sprinkle over % cup granu- lated sugar. Add this to 1 quart of cream with 1 tumbler of sugar and freeze. Glace. Half gallon of cream, 1^ dozen macaroons pounded fine. Pour a little of this cream over them and allow to stand until they soften. Beat until very fine, then add remainder of cream and freeze. Sweeten to taste. Vanilla Oream. Three pints of rich cream. Have % of a vanilla bean, put on the stove with % pint of water and let it reduce %. Set it out to cool. To cream add 1% tumblers of sugarVanilla Cream and this vanilla when it is cold. Freeze. Peppermint Cream. Take 1 pound of peppermint candy and crush fine, pour over it 2 quarts of creamPeppermint Cream and let soak all night. The next day add 2 more quarts of cream, then freeze. Lallah Bookh. One pint of cream, 1 pint of rich milk, 1 tumbler of granulated sugar, % vanilla bean, yolks of 6 eggsLallah Bookh. Scald the milk in a double boiler with the vanilla bean cut in pieces. Have yolks and sugar beaten to a cream and stir in gradually the hot milk; return to boiler for few minutes, stirring constantly.
